Hands-On at Whitcomb’s, Summer 2022: Tonics, Elixirs, and Teas
In this three-class series, learn the basic tools and skills needed to build your home apothecary, based on personal preference with the support of folk methods of medicine. Additional classes in Balms and Salves (July 30), and Tinctures and Floral Waters (August 27). Take one, two or all three classes.
In the Tonics, Elixirs, and Teas class, we’ll discuss the process of building tonics, health elixirs and mixing teas appropriate for you and your family. Complete instruction in the use of appropriate plant matter, building the right mixtures for common ailments, and a basic herb list for personal use will be presented. Participants will mix a personal tea blend on site for home use. Please bring a suitable container with lid, and pen/paper. Information packets will also be supplied.
